Cosmic Acceleration: Past And Present [PDF]

open access: yes, 2011
Our Universe has an exciting history of accelerated expansion. Following its inception in an event known as the big bang, the Universe underwent a phase of exponential expansion called inflation.

Secondary Bile Acids and Short Chain Fatty Acids in the Colon: A Focus on Colonic Microbiome, Cell Proliferation, Inflammation, and Cancer

open access: yesInternational Journal of Molecular Sciences, 2019
Secondary bile acids (BAs) and short chain fatty acids (SCFAs), two major types of bacterial metabolites in the colon, cause opposing effects on colonic inflammation at chronically high physiological levels. Primary BAs play critical roles in cholesterol

Secondary building units as the turning point in the development of the reticular chemistry of MOFs

open access: yesScience Advances, 2018
The SBU approach facilitated the development of permanently porous MOFs with unique properties, chemistry, and applications. The secondary building unit (SBU) approach was a turning point in the discovery of permanently porous metal-organic frameworks ...

Radiochemical measurements on neutron sources [PDF]

open access: yes, 1958
The investigations described in this thesis relate to the development of an accurate method for the comparison of strengths of weak neutron sources with different spectra. This is part of a programme for the establishment of an absolute neutron standard.
